Table 2-37: RF Commands (cont.)
Item Description
SEARCH:SPECTral:LIST? This query will return a list of all automatically placed peak markers displayed in the frequency
domain graticule. (To return information about manual markers, use the MARKER:M<x>
commands.)
SELect:RF_AMPlitude This command switches the RF Amplitude vs. Timetracedisplayonoroffinthetimedomain
graticule.
SELect:RF_AVErage This command switches the R F Average trace display on or off in the frequency domain
graticule.
SELect:RF_FREQuency This command switches the RF Frequency vs. Time trace display on or off in the time domain
graticule.
SELect:RF_MAXHold This command switches the frequency domain Max Hold trace display on or off in the
frequency domain graticule.
SELect:RF_MINHold This command switches the frequency domain Min Hold trace display on or off in the frequency
domain graticule.
SELect:RF_NORMal This command switches the frequency domain Normal trace display on or off in the frequency
domain graticule.
SELect:RF_PHASe This command switches the RF Phase vs. Time trace display on or off in the time domain
graticule.
Save and Recall Command Group
UsethecommandsintheSaveandRecallCommand Group to store and retrieve
wav
eforms and settings. When you save a setup, you save all the settings of the
oscilloscope. When you recall a setup, the oscilloscope restores itself tothestate
it was in when you originally saved the setting.
NOTE. External filestructureisasfollows:
E: is the USB memory device plugged into the first USB port on the front of the
oscilloscope.
F: is the USB memory device plugged into the second USB port on the front of the
oscilloscope. (Not available for MDO3000 models).
G: and H: are the USB memory device plugged into the USB ports on the rear o f
the oscilloscope. (Not available for MDO3000 models.)
I: — Z are for network storage.
